Features

  • With the Escalante Racer 2, you get performance-focused speed with connection to the ground for your fastest training runs and race days
  • Shoes have roomy toe boxes and zero heel-to-toe drop, built to keep you comfortable and keep you running the way you were designed to
  • Zero-drop shoes are built to place your foot in a natural position, with a stable and confident foundation to run on
  • Original Altra EGOâ„¢ foam is designed to harmonize the balance between responsiveness and comfort
  • Gridlike grooves in the midsole are designed to provide flexibility and movement
  • Outsole technology encourages natural movement underfoot
  • Weight (half pair): 8.8 oz.

Sizing Notes

Altra’s unique FootShape™ toe box and zero to low shoes are built to place your foot in a natural position, with a stable and confident foundation to run on. When fitting, be sure to allow a full thumb’s width in front of your toes. If your feet are used to cramped toe boxes, Altra shoes may feel a little big at first. Give your toes some time to get used to the newfound wiggle room.

Altra offers a range of FootShape fits:

Original Fit: The fit that started it all, Original is the roomiest of the 3 options from Altra.

Standard Fit: The most common fit from Altra is right in the middle of Original and Slim.

Slim Fit: The slimmest-fitting Altra option still allows room for your toes to spread out naturally.

IS THIS SHOE TRUE TO SIZE? The product Features above will provide a suggestion if Altra advises you to size up or down in this particular shoe. If no such note exists, please order your regular size.

An instant classic

I've run three pairs of Escalante Racer 1.0s down to the nubs, they are my all-time favorite running shoe (and the original Escalante before that). So to say I was apprehensive about a 2.0 iteration would be an understatement. But I'm very happy with what Altra did here. They kept the essential qualities that made the ER great, updated with some new materials and a few small tweaks. I find them to be a little more stiff, not as flexible in the mid- and outsole. It's a tradeoff of agility for greater stability. But I appreciate the firm ground feel, and they still feel light and responsive. I expect they will have better durability as well.

Tried to love, but returning for the original racer

It is a good shoe and I really wanted to love it, but it just does not fit my foot quite like the original racer. It feels just a bit heavier and stiffer. Also, it is just a bit harder on my feet and ankles than the original. I think Altra tried to add a little extra room in these, which is generally good, but they do not quite conform to my feet as well as the original. I found my feet moving around too much within the shoe when I am starting and stopping. I've been wearing Altra's for over a decade and these are still among the best shoes Altra has made to date. They may be a good fit for other people, but ultimately the original is just better across the board for me.
